My friend wants to know if you can use "micro" 4mm bullet connecters to connect an esc to a motor. His not sure if he will lose power by using these.He doesn't have a micro he is using a slash 1/10 scale sc and is about to solder his plugs on his new esc and motor

What's a "micro" 4mm bullet? Smaller than 4mm?

If it's really 4mm bullets it should be fine, just be sure they are well insulated so they can't short out with each other.
